1. What is the CD Interest Formula?

The CD (Certificate of Deposit) interest formula calculates the maturity amount of an investment with monthly compounding. It provides an accurate assessment of how much your investment will grow over time with compound interest.

2. How Does the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the CD interest formula:

\[ A = P \times (1 + \frac{R}{12})^{(12 \times T)} \]

Where:

Explanation: The formula accounts for monthly compounding by dividing the annual rate by 12 and raising to the power of 12 times the number of years.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What is monthly compounding?
A: Monthly compounding means interest is calculated and added to the principal each month, allowing your investment to grow faster over time.

Q2: How does compounding frequency affect returns?
A: More frequent compounding (monthly vs annually) results in higher returns because interest is calculated on previously earned interest more often.

Q3: Are CD interest rates fixed?
A: Typically yes, most CDs offer fixed interest rates for the term duration, providing predictable returns.

Q4: What are early withdrawal penalties?
A: Most CDs charge penalties for early withdrawal, which can significantly reduce your earnings if you access funds before maturity.

Q5: How do CD returns compare to other investments?
A: CDs generally offer lower returns than stocks but provide guaranteed returns and are FDIC insured, making them safer investments.
